概括
这项研究引入了一种新的正电荷纳米过膜,用于精确的离子分离. 新的聚胺基膜在分离和离子方面具有很高的选择性,这对于各种工业应用至关重要.
科学领域:
- 材料科学 材料科学 材料科学
- 化学工程是化学工程的重要组成部分.
- 环境科学 环境科学
背景情况:
- 传统的纳米过 (NF) 膜在离子分离方面面临限制,原因是表面负电荷.
- 实现高离子离子选择性对于-分离和水软化等应用至关重要.
研究的目的:
- 开发一种先进的,带正电荷的纳米过膜,用于精确的离子分离.
- 为了克服传统的聚胺基膜的性能限制.
主要方法:
- 聚乙胺 (PEI) 和1,3,5-三甲 (TBB) 的界面聚合,以创建PEI-TBB选择性层.
- 复合膜的制造具有超薄厚度 (~95 nm) 和 6.5 Å 的孔径.
- 表面电荷的表征 (pH 7时泽塔电位+20.9 mV) 和分离性能.
主要成果:
- PEI-TBB膜的水透率为4.2 L·m−2·h−1·bar−1.1. 这是一个非常好的结果.
- 对各种双价盐的排斥率达到了>90%,对于NaCl/MgCl2和LiCl/MgCl2.2,分离因子达到了>15.
- 一个三阶段的NF工艺将Mg2+/Li+质量比从50降至0.11,总分离因子为455.
结论:
- 开发的基于聚胺的NF膜提供了精确的离子离子分离能力.
- 在连续过和高压下表现出卓越的运行稳定性.
- 显示了需要选择性离子去除和回收的应用的巨大潜力.

Ion Exchange
607
Ion exchange chromatography separates charged molecules from a solution by reversibly exchanging them with mobile, or 'active', ions associated with the oppositely charged stationary phase. This method can be used to separate ions, soften and deionize water, and purify solutions. The polymers comprising the ion-exchange column are high-molecular-weight and chemically stable polymers, crosslinked to be porous and essentially insoluble. Dialysis
727
Dialysis is a diffusion-based purification process that separates analyte molecules from a complex matrix. This is accomplished by allowing molecules in the solution to pass through a semipermeable membrane into a liquid on the other side. The membrane is usually made of cellulose acetate or cellulose nitrate, and the second liquid must be miscible with the solution. Potentiometry: Membrane Electrodes
606
Membrane electrodes, also known as p-ion electrodes, use membranes that selectively interact with free analyte ions, generating a potential difference across the membrane. The resulting membrane potential, known as the asymmetry potential, is not zero even when analyte concentrations on both sides of the membrane are equal.
